- [ ] Step 7: Archive cold storage buckets (Glacierline tier). Confirm both ceremony witnesses are present, verify bucket manifests match the Oxbow ledger, then seal the archive key shares. Plugin authors may observe but not handle shares. Once sealed, the archive index itself is encrypted and can only be reopened with the passphrase below.

vault phrase of badup-hahig = tamael-aldael-kelmir-istael-fenok-istwyn-tamius-jorath-oliion

### Step 4: Enable the MemLattice Collector

Before cutting the 3.2 release, the MemLattice GPU profiler must replace the deprecated HeapTrace agent on every Ovenbird training node. Verify that HeapTrace has been fully drained — overlapping collectors corrupt allocation timelines. Once drained, install the collector package and confirm the daemon registers with the Quillfort aggregator. Apply exactly the configuration shown below, with no local overrides.

deployment values, hawef-badug:
[kelath]
team = gormir
access_code = ac_51231d
owner = sileth.soriel
host = kelath.qirvandata.corp
port = 8443
peer = jorius.zarqeltech.test
salt = 4072400a
pin = 2894

Handover — Dalbreth Works capacity decision. Marit: Line 4 at Voskell plant is at 92% utilisation. Options are a second shift or the Tarnby expansion; capex differs by roughly 3.1m. Finance needs the sensitivity tables by Friday. I've flagged the supplier constraints in the shared folder. The confidential context for the expansion decision follows below.

internal memo for yahag-tahog: The pricing group signed off on a budget of $152.8 million for Project Soriel.

Squallcast fan-out distributes weather alerts from the Stormline ingest queue to all subscriber channels. Support should know: delivery failures retry three times with backoff, then land in the dead-letter view. Duplicate alerts usually mean a subscriber registered twice; dedupe by channel handle. All diagnostic calls go through the internal RelayNest gateway and require authentication — unauthenticated requests return a 401 with no body, which is expected, not an outage. Diagnostic tooling for the support tier should use the key below.

gateway credential: kto3_qfe